An experiment was conducted at Agricultural Research Station, Raikhali, Rangamati during three consecutive cropping seasons (winter) from November 1998 to March 2001. A randomized complete block design was followed with twelve fertilizer combinations of N (0, 25, 50, 75), P2O5 (0, 50, 75, 100) and K20 (0, 30, 60, 90 kg/ha) to determine optimum doses of N, P and K for cultivation of bushbean (Phaseolus vulgaris L.). Plant height, number of branch, number of pods/plant, pod yield, gross and net return, benefit- cost ratio increased with increase of fertilizer dose. Fertilizer levels did not affect pod size, flowering and harvesting time. The maximum plant height (33.7cm), number of branch (5.62/plant), number of pods (16.53/plant), pod yield (17.47 t/ha), net return (Tk.1.38 lakh/ha) and BCR (3.65) was obtained when N, P2O5 and K2O were applied at the rate of 75, 100 and 90 kg/ha, respectively.

To determine the optimum dose of N, P, and K for obtaining the maximum yield, quality and profit of bush bean cultivation in the eastern hilly area of Bangladesh.

The experiment was conducted at the Agricultural Research Station (ARS), Raikhali, Chandraghona, Rangamati during three consecutive cropping seasons (winter) from November 1998 to March 2001. The experimental station ARS, Raikhali is situated in the southeastern part of Bangladesh (Latitude 22024’N and 91057’E Longitude). The soil was silty loam with pH 5.5 to 6.0. Before opening the land, the soil samples were taken from ten spots of the experimental area and analyzed from the Soil Science Division of Bangladesh Agricultural Research Institute. The soil analysis reports of the experimental field are cited. Table 1. Sampling year pH Organic matter (%) Total N (%) Exchangeable status (meq/100g soil) Available status (g/g soil) Ca Mg K P S Fe Zn 1998 5.6 1.67 0.083 3.1 0.89 0.21 12 6.7 226 3.0 1999 5.2 1.83 0.097 3.4 0.68 0.19 17 6.3 234 4.0 2000 5.4 1.76 0.092 3.0 0.62 0.18 15 6.7 215 3.0 Critical level -- -- 2.0 0.5 0.12 10 1.0 4 0.6 A randomized complete block design was followed with three replications of twelve combination of N, P and K fertilizers. The unit plot size was 3x 3m accommodating 300 pits per plot at 30X15cm spacing. The land was manured with a common dose (5t/ha) of cowdung and fertilized with twelve different doses of N = 0, 25, 50, 75; P2O5 = 0, 50, 75, 100 and K2O = 0, 30, 60, 90 kg/ha in the form of urea, TSP and MP, respectively. The entire amount of cowdung, TSP and half of urea and MP were applied at the time of final land preparation and the rest was applied at 30 days after planting. Variety BARI Jharshim-2 was used. It is a high yielding semi-determinate, dwarf, bushy type plant having profuse bearing habit of narrow, straight and round pod, which are suitable to use as fresh bean and dry seeds. Two seeds per pit were sown and one seedling was kept per pit after thinning at 15 DAS. Weeding, irrigation and other cultural practices were done as and when required. Data were recorded from 20 randomly selected plants for individual plant performance and from total plot for per hectare yield. Data on all characters were analyzed statistically following standard methods.

Most of the yield and yield contributing characters were significantly influenced by different levels of nitrogen, phosphorus and potassium. Comparatively lower influences were observed in case of potassium and nitrogen fertilizer than phosphorus. The maximum number of pods per plant (16.5) and weight of pods per plant (79.0 g) as well as pod yield per hectare (17.47t) were obtained from the highest fertilizer level N75P100K90 followed by N75P75K90 (15.1 pods/plant, 74.2g/plant and 16.7 t/ha) that was statistically similar. The minimum number of pods (7.57) and pod yield per plant (37.5g) and per hectare (7.56t) were obtained from the control, which was statistically similar with the dose when no nitrogen (N0P75K60) (8.77t/ha) and no phosphorus were applied (N50P0K60) (10.1 t/ha). The maximum GR (Tk. 1.76 lakh/ha), NR (Tk. 1.38 lakh/ha) and BCR (3.65) were obtained from the same fertilizer level N75P100K90 while that was minimum in absolute control (no fertilizer) plot. Thus it can be concluded that the fertilizer level N75P100K90 was the most profitable dose for bushbean cultivation in the valleys of the eastern hilly areas of Bangladesh.
